What problem does it solve?

Fast security scanning of the current repository to surface vulnerabilities, secrets, and SAST issues.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Incremental PR scans for changes, full repository quick scans by default, and language detection from manifests; supports deterministic MCP-based scanning with a CLI fallback when MCP is unavailable.

How do I run a fast security scan on my code repository?

Run a fast security scan on your code repository by using the Endor MCP tool with quick_scan enabled to surface default scan types including vulnerabilities, dependencies, SAST, and secrets.

Can I scan only the changed code in a pull request for vulnerabilities?

Yes, you can scan only the changed code in a pull request by enabling incremental PR scans, which target vulnerabilities, secrets, and SAST issues specifically within the new changes.

What is the difference between a full repository quick scan and an incremental PR scan?

A full repository quick scan evaluates the entire codebase for vulnerabilities and secrets, whereas an incremental PR scan focuses only on the modified files in a pull request for faster feedback.

Does the security scanner work if the MCP server is unavailable?

Yes, the security scanner works if the MCP server is unavailable by automatically falling back to a CLI-based scanning approach to ensure vulnerabilities and SAST issues are still detected.

What types of security issues can I detect with a codebase SAST scan?

A codebase SAST scan detects vulnerabilities, dependency issues, hardcoded secrets, and static application security testing problems by analyzing manifests and source code.

Do I need to manually specify the programming language for a repository security scan?

No, you do not need to manually specify the programming language because the scanner automatically detects languages from project manifests during the quick scan process.
